Warning Signs You Need Odor Removal After Water Damage

Early detection is key to preventing costly repairs and ensuring your home remains a safe haven. Be on the lookout for these warning signs, which show the need for professional Odor Removal After Water Damage services:

Musty Odors That Won't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ors that linger despite regular cleaning and ventilation may show water damage or a moisture issue. Don't ignore these smells, as they can lead to further problems.

Warped or Discolored Drywall

Water damage can cause drywall to become warped or discolored. If you notice these changes, it's ess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and odors.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or excessive moisture. Don't delay in addressing this issue, as it can lead to costly repairs and unpleasant odors.

Visible Stains or Water Marks

Visible stains or water marks on ceilings, walls, or floors can show water damage. Address these issues quickly to prevent further damage and odors.

Unpleasant Smells in Your Attic or Crawlspace

Musty odors in your attic or crawlspace can show water damage or a moisture issue. Don't ignore these smells, as they can lead to further problems.

Increased Humidity or Moisture Levels

High humidity or moisture levels in your home can create an ideal environment for mold and bacteria to grow, leading to unpleasant odors. Use a hygrometer to monitor your home's humidity levels and address any issues quickly.

Odor Removal After Water Damage v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ill, minimal damage, and no strong odors Yes No You can clean up the spill and dry the area yourself.
Large water spill, significant damage, and strong odors No Yes You'll need professional equipment and expertise to safely and effectively remove the water and odors.
Water damage in a sensitive area, such as a kitchen or bathroom No Yes These areas need specialized care to prevent further damage and health risks.
Visible signs of mold or mildew No Yes Mold and mildew need professional removal to ensure your home is safe and healthy.
Water damage in a crawlspace or attic No Yes These areas can be difficult to access and need specialized equipment to safely and effectively remove water and odors.
Unpleasant odors that persist despite cleaning and ventilation No Yes Professional equipment and techniques are necessary to remove these odors and prevent future growth.

Common Questions About Odor Removal After Water Damage

Will insurance cover the cost of Odor Removal After Water Damage services?

Yes, many insurance policies cover water damage and odor removal services. But, it's essential to review your policy and contact your insurance provider to confirm coverage.

How long does the Odor Removal After Water Damage process take?

The duration of the process dep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Typically, our team can complete the process within 3-5 days, but this may vary in complex cases.

Can I prevent water damage and odors in my home?

Yes, reg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ent water damage and odors. Check your home's roof, gutters, and downspouts regularly, and address any issues quickly.

Will I need to vacate my home during the Odor Removal After Water Damage process?

In most cases, you can stay in your home during the process, but it's essential to follow our technicians' instructions and take necessary precautions to ensure your safety.
